ELLICOTT CITY, MD — A construction project designed to improve the existing storm drain adjacent to 4701 Hale Haven Drive in Ellicott City is underway and should wrap up by mid-February.

The project will include the installation of a stone channel and an additional storm drainpipe, as well as grading, in the open field next to 4701 to relieve flooding in the adjacent neighborhood.

The project is not expected to impact the flow of vehicular or pedestrian traffic. Property owners affected by the project will be notified prior to the start date.
